About the book

In «The Collected Works of James Hogg,» readers are invited to explore the rich tapestry of Hogg's literary creations, encompassing poetry, prose, and tales that reflect the intricate interplay of Scottish culture, folklore, and personal introspection. Hogg's distinctive narrative style, characterized by a vivid realism infused with a Romantic sensibility, immerses the audience in the psychological landscapes of his characters. This comprehensive compilation not only showcases Hogg's pioneering contributions to Scottish literature but also situates his work within the broader context of 19th-century Romanticism, addressing themes of identity, spirituality, and the natural world. James Hogg, often hailed as the 'Ettrick Shepherd,' drew upon his pastoral upbringing in the Scottish Borders to craft stories imbued with a deep sense of place and character. His experiences as a shepherd and his engagement with the oral traditions of Scotland profoundly influenced his writing, allowing him to create an authentic voice that resonated with both contemporary and future audiences. Hogg's unique perspective on the tensions between rural life and burgeoning industrialization provides a critical lens through which to understand his works. «The Collected Works of James Hogg» is an essential addition to any literary library, offering insights into the complexities of human experience through the eyes of one of Scotland's most innovative writers. Whether you are a scholar, a lover of literature, or a curious reader, Hogg's nuanced exploration of emotion, nature, and societal change will undoubtedly leave a lasting impression.
